Recently a piece of shocking news comes to hear that an 18-year-old man fell while climbing Mt Ngungun, the sixth-tallest peak in the Glass House Mountains in Queensland’s Sunshine Coast hinterland, on Saturday. the Name of the boy is Peter Garlick, this news makes every rock climber shocked. 

Peter Garlick Wiki

Peter was an 18-year-old experienced climber who ‘died doing what he loved. Several traumatized onlookers watched on as he plunged about 40 meters down the cliff face about midday, suffering fatal injuries in the fall. As per the sources, Peter Garlick was studying teaching at the Queensland University of Technology in Brisbane and was a well-liked and respected member of the school’s rock climbing club, the QUT Cliffhangers.

He regularly adventured throughout southeast Queensland and New South Wales on the hunt for the best mountains to climb, and had an exceptional talent.

Mr Garlick was so invested in the sport that he even took a job at Urban Climb in West End, who stayed shut on Sunday to mourn the loss of their team member.

Martin Worth, who has been climbing for more than three decades and was at Mount Ngungun on Saturday morning, said while he did not witness the incident, the teenager was an experienced climber. 

Mt Ngungun was closed for the afternoon while emergency services worked to recover the body.
